Understanding the Core Principles of High-Frequency Trading
At the heart of many strategies similar to jackpotraider lies the concept of high-frequency trading (HFT). HFT isn't simply about speed; it's about identifying and exploiting tiny inefficiencies in the market that are often invisible to human traders. These inefficiencies can be caused by a multitude of factors, including order imbalances, latency differences between exchanges, and even news releases that are fractions of a second ahead of the general public. The core idea is to execute a large number of orders at incredibly high speeds, capitalizing on these small price discrepancies to generate significant profits over time. This requires sophisticated algorithms, extremely low-latency connections to exchanges, and powerful computing infrastructure.
The allure of HFT is obvious: potentially substantial returns with minimal perceived effort. However, the reality is far more complex. Successful HFT requires significant capital investment, a team of highly skilled programmers and quantitative analysts, and a deep understanding of market microstructure. Furthermore, regulatory scrutiny of HFT has been increasing in recent years, with concerns raised about its potential to exacerbate market volatility and disadvantage smaller investors. It's important to realize HFT isn't a 'get-rich-quick' scheme, but rather a highly competitive and technologically demanding field. The barrier to entry is substantial, and the margin for error is razor-thin. Many systems positioned as readily accessible to retail traders are, in fact, simplified imitations of these complex strategies.

Exploring Automated Trading Indicators and Their Role
Automated trading systems often rely on a suite of technical indicators to generate trading signals. These indicators are mathematical calculations based on historical price and volume data, designed to identify potential trading opportunities. Common indicators include Moving Averages, Relative Strength Index (RSI), Moving Average Convergence Divergence (MACD), and Bollinger Bands. Each indicator has its own strengths and weaknesses, and no single indicator is foolproof. A successful system typically combines multiple indicators to create a more robust and reliable trading signal. The key is understanding how these indicators work and tailoring them to specific market conditions. Simply plugging in pre-configured indicators is unlikely to yield consistent results.
The selection and optimization of these indicators is a critical part of any automated trading strategy. Traders must carefully backtest their chosen indicators on historical data to assess their performance and identify potential parameters that yield the best results. However, it’s important to remember that past performance is not necessarily indicative of future results. Market conditions can change over time, and an indicator that worked well in the past may not be effective in the future. Furthermore, over-optimization of indicators can lead to what is known as 'curve fitting,' where the system performs exceptionally well on historical data but fails to deliver similar results in live trading, because it’s been tailored too closely to past events rather than fundamental market principles.
- Moving Averages: Identify trends and potential support/resistance levels.
- RSI: Measures the magnitude of recent price changes to evaluate overbought or oversold conditions.
- MACD: Shows the relationship between two moving averages of prices.
- Bollinger Bands: Measure market volatility and identify potential breakout points.

The Role of Backtesting and Forward Testing in Strategy Validation
Before risking any real capital, thorough testing of any trading strategy, including those related to approaches like jackpotraider, is absolutely essential. Backtesting involves applying the strategy to historical data to assess its performance over a specific period. This can provide valuable insights into the strategy’s potential profitability, drawdown (maximum loss), and overall risk profile. However, backtesting has its limitations. It relies on historical data, which may not accurately reflect future market conditions. Furthermore, backtesting results can be easily manipulated through techniques like curve fitting, as mentioned previously.
Forward testing, also known as paper trading, offers a more realistic assessment of a strategy’s performance. This involves simulating trades in a live market environment using real-time data, but without risking any actual capital. Forward testing allows you to observe how the strategy performs under current market conditions and identify any potential flaws or limitations that may not have been apparent during backtesting. It’s also a valuable opportunity to familiarize yourself with the system’s interface and trading mechanics. Successful forward testing over a sufficient period is a strong indicator that the strategy may be worth considering for live trading, but it's still not a guarantee of success.
- Define Clear Metrics: Establish specific criteria for evaluating the strategy's performance (e.g., profit factor, win rate, maximum drawdown).
- Use Sufficient Data: Backtest and forward test the strategy over a substantial period to ensure the results are statistically significant.
- Account for Transaction Costs: Include commissions, slippage, and other transaction costs in your testing to get a realistic assessment of profitability.
- Monitor Performance Regularly: Continuously track the strategy’s performance and make adjustments as needed.
It’s important to note that even with rigorous testing, there is always a risk of loss when trading in the financial markets. No strategy can consistently predict market movements with 100% accuracy.
Understanding the Risks Associated with Automated Trading Systems
While automated trading systems offer potential benefits, they also come with inherent risks. One of the most significant risks is the possibility of technical failures. Software glitches, network outages, or exchange errors can all disrupt the system’s operation and lead to unexpected losses. It’s crucial to have robust risk management protocols in place to mitigate these risks, such as setting stop-loss orders and limiting position sizes. Another risk is the potential for algorithmic errors. Even a small mistake in the code can have significant consequences, potentially leading to rapid and substantial losses.
Over-reliance on automation can also be a pitfall. Traders should not blindly trust the system to make all the decisions. It’s important to actively monitor the system’s performance and intervene when necessary. Furthermore, market conditions can change unexpectedly, rendering a previously profitable strategy ineffective. A system that performed well in a bull market may struggle in a bear market, and vice versa. Therefore, it's crucial to adapt the strategy to changing market dynamics and be prepared to adjust or even abandon it if necessary. Lastly, scams and fraudulent systems are prevalent in the automated trading space. Be wary of systems that promise unrealistic returns or lack transparency.
